What does it mean to look to Christ alone for salvation?

Looking to Christ alone means relying solely on Him for our salvation and righteousness.

Looking to Christ alone signifies placing our full trust in Jesus as the sole source of our salvation. It involves turning away from self-reliance and recognizing that all our righteousness comes from Him. The sermon emphasizes that our works do not contribute to our salvation; rather, they flow from a heart transformed by God's grace. By focusing on Christ and His finished work, we acknowledge that He is our only hope and refuge. This focus enables believers to live a life marked by faith and obedience that stems from gratitude rather than obligation.
Scripture References: Romans 3:21-22, Hebrews 12:2
